«scripts» 태그된 질문

스크립트는 "일반 텍스트"파일로 작성된 일련의 지침입니다. 스크립트 인터프리터 (예 : Bash 또는 다른 쉘, Python, Perl, Ruby 등)는 파일을 읽고 명령 프롬프트에 입력 된 것처럼 명령을 수행합니다.


2
/ bin, / sbin, / usr / bin, / usr / sbin, / usr / local / bin, / usr / local / sbin의 차이점
명령 파일이있는 6 개의 디렉토리가 있습니다. 이들은 /bin, /sbin, /usr/bin, /usr/sbin, /usr/local/bin와 /usr/local/sbin. 이것들의 차이점은 무엇입니까? 직접 스크립트를 작성하는 경우 어디에 추가해야합니까? 관련 : 우분투 파일 시스템 레이아웃을 이해하는 방법? Linux에서 / usr / bin vs / usr / local / bin bash 스크립트를 어디에 두어야합니까


4
ssh : 자동으로 키 수락
이 작은 유틸리티 스크립트를 작성했습니다. for h in $SERVER_LIST; do ssh $h "uptime"; done 에 새 서버가 추가되면 다음 $SERVER_LIST과 같이 스크립트가 중지됩니다. The authenticity of host 'blah.blah.blah (10.10.10.10)' can't be established. RSA key fingerprint is a4:d9:a4:d9:a4:d9a4:d9:a4:d9a4:d9a4:d9a4:d9a4:d9a4:d9. Are you sure you want to continue connecting (yes/no)? 나는 시도했다 yes: for …
218 ssh  scripts  openssh 

12
명령 행에서 모든 저장소 및 PPA 목록을 설치 스크립트로 가져 오려면 어떻게해야합니까?
시스템에 설치된 모든 패키지 를 나열 하는 방법을 알고 있습니다. 그러나 키를 포함한 리포지토리 설정을 복제하기 위해 새 컴퓨터에서 실행할 수있는 스크립트로 모든 리포지토리 및 PPA 목록을 가져올 수 있습니까? 나는 /etc/apt/sources.listand 를 조사 할 수 있다는 것을 알고 /etc/apt/sources.list.d있지만 새로운 시스템에서 모든 명령 을 실행하는 스크립트 를 생성 하는 …




6
터미널 창을 열고 명령을 실행하는 스크립트를 어떻게 만들 수 있습니까?
우분투 머신을 시작할 때 실행해야 할 스크립트가 세 개 있는데, 개발 환경에서 사용하는 서비스를 시작합니다. 이를 위해 수동으로 세 개의 터미널을 열고 명령을 입력하십시오. 세 개의 터미널을 열고 각 터미널에서 하나의 명령을 실행하는 스크립트를 작성하는 방법이 있습니까? (각 명령은 별도의 터미널 창에 있어야 출력을 볼 수 있습니다).

11
쉘 스크립트에서 선택 메뉴를 작성하는 방법
간단한 bash 스크립트를 만들고 다음과 같이 선택 메뉴를 만들고 싶습니다. $./script echo "Choose your option:" 1) Option 1 2) Option 2 3) Option 3 4) Quit 그리고 사용자의 선택에 따라 다른 작업을 실행하고 싶습니다. 나는 bash 쉘 스크립팅 멍청한 놈입니다. 웹에서 몇 가지 답변을 찾았지만 실제로는 아무것도 얻지 못했습니다.

7
공백이있는 'for'루프에서 완전한 줄을 읽는 방법
for파일 루프 를 실행하려고하는데 전체 줄을 표시하고 싶습니다. 그러나 대신 마지막 단어 만 표시합니다. 나는 완전한 선을 원한다. for j in `cat ./file_wget_med` do echo $j done 실행 후 결과 : Found. 내 데이터는 다음과 같습니다. $ cat file_wget_med 2013-09-11 14:27:03 ERROR 404: Not Found.

10
Windows에서 .EXE 파일처럼 두 번 클릭하여 스크립트를 실행하는 방법은 무엇입니까?
.exeWindows에서 파일 처럼 두 번 클릭하여 bash 스크립트를 실행 가능하게하려면 어떻게 해야합니까? 런처를 만들고 스크립트를 할당 하려고 시도했지만 두 가지 결과가 있습니다. 터미널이 반짝 거리고 사라지고 아무 것도 수행되지 않습니다. 작업하려면 터미널에서 실행되도록 지정해야합니다. 스크립트에 tomcat의 모든 종속성을 포함하여 오프라인 PC에 tomcat을 설치하는 스크립트가 있습니다. 스크립트를 사용하는 대부분의 사람들이 우분투에 …

5
'chmod u + x'대 'chmod + x'
차이점은 무엇이며 chmod u+x단지는 chmod +x? u+x스크립트를 실행 가능하게 만드는 데 사용 되는 수많은 자습서를 보았습니다 . 그러나를 생략 u해도 효과가없는 것 같습니다.

7
.sh 파일을 실행할 수 없습니다 : / bin / bash ^ M : 잘못된 인터프리터
쉘 스크립트를 실행하고 싶었습니다. -rwxr-x--x 1 root root 17234 Jun 6 18:31 create_mgw_3shelf_6xIPNI1P.sh 표준 절차를 시도했지만이 오류가 발생했습니다. ./create_mgw_3shelf_6xIPNI1P.sh localhost 389 -l /opt/fews/sessions/AMGWM19/log/2013-06-06-143637_CLA-0 DEBUG cd/etc/opt/ldapfiles/ldif_in ; ./create_mgw_3shelf_6xIPNI1P.sh localhost 389 -l /opt/fews/sessions/AMGWM19/log/2013-06-06-143637_CLA-0 **ERROR sh: ./create_mgw_3shelf_6xIPNI1P.sh: /bin/bash^M: bad interpreter: No such file or directory** 무슨 뜻인가요? 나는 그룹 의 root사용자 로 이것을하고있었습니다 …

11
스크립트가 루트로 실행 중인지 어떻게 확인할 수 있습니까?
간단한 bash 스크립트를 작성하고 있지만 루트로 실행 중인지 여부를 확인해야합니다. 나는 그것을 할 수있는 매우 간단한 방법이 있다는 것을 알고 있지만, 방법을 모른다. 그냥 명확합니다 : 스크립트 작성하는 간단한 방법 무엇 foo.sh은 , 그래서 명령 ./foo.sh출력 0하고 명령 sudo ./foo.sh출력 1?
104 bash  scripts  root 

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.